Tinyfly v2.0 - the layout is based on the well known rp2040-tiny from waveshare but made for switch.

1. All necessary pads are exposed and the LED DIN as well.
2. Resistors and capacitors are 0402 size for easier soldering
3. Default D0,CMD,CLK resistors are 100,100,47ohm respectively

I've attached here the gerber file and bom/pick and place files.

Updates:
Tinyfly v2.0.zip
- Initial Release
Tinyfly v2.0b.zip - Added extra pads for GND and 3V3 line on the right side. Swapped CPU and RST at the bottom part. Some components are changed to basic parts if planning to fabricate using JLCPCB.

I am using ptc plate too. It heats rapidly and conveniently. Can i add 47ohm instead of 100ohm on data0 and cmd. TBH 100ohm causing me trouble with long glitching time(samsung emmc) than 47ohm. I have switched to used 47ohm at default because of the glitching time.

Yes it is okay. I've been using 100/100/47 due to v1 compatibility and it works for all switches without any further modification. Long glitches I did not encounter yet. Mostly hynix chips has issues. The one i posted yesterday with video has samsung chip v2, and glitches instantly like 1sec.

Yes it is okay. I've been using 100/100/47 due to v1 compatibility and it works for all switches without any further modification. Long glitches I did not encounter yet. Mostly hynix chips has issues. The one i posted yesterday with video has samsung chip v2, and glitches instantly like 1sec.
The long glitching happend to be 100ohm on samsung specificaly, not always but sometime. Skhynix and toshiba glitching time about 6-7s but stable ones and i can use either 47 and 100ohm on these two. After some devices return with long glitching time on samsung emmc i have to use 47ohm again on samsung.
